Job Description

Senior Systems Administrator

Thrive

• Take technical ownership of assigned clients, including escalated issues, ensuring resolution of infrastructure- and business-critical problems. • Perform advanced support and troubleshooting for escalated incidents, including network, server, cloud, business application, and workstation issues. • Evaluate client infrastructure, systems, software, and processes to identify deficiencies and recommend improvements or projects to meet client needs. • Lead major incident outages, conduct post-incident reviews, and drive corrective actions, including root cause analysis and documentation. • Identify systemic and pervasive issues, perform trend analysis, and implement permanent solutions to prevent future problems. • Design and validate multi-tenant solutions, including identity management, networking, security, disaster recovery, zero trust, hybrid AD/Entra, Intune baselines, conditional access, identity governance, complex networking/firewall policies, SASE/SWG, and SIEM integrations. • Benchmark, tune, and optimize systems for performance, capacity, and scalability. • Create and maintain documentation, network diagrams, change control approvals, and knowledge base content. • Develop and maintain automation and operational tools, including PowerShell modules, RMM policies, deployment pipelines, compliance checks, and monitoring improvements. • Deliver training, mentor junior engineers, and contribute to team readiness and process improvement initiatives.

Job Requirements

  • 7+ years in IT operations/engineering with MSP or large enterprise experience.
  • Expertise in identity, networking, cloud, security, and automation.
  • Deep experience with Windows Server, Active Directory, Azure AD/Entra, Exchange/M365 admin, Intune, and Virtualization.
  • Proven leadership in major incidents and complex transformations.
  • Strong documentation and stakeholder communication; executive-ready briefings.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ication, documentation, and time-management skills.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a team environment.
  • Availability to work after hours and participate in on-call rotations as required.
  • Excellent customer service skills.
